In the Vezirköprü district of Samsun, 19 people, including 10 students, were injured in an accident involving 5 vehicles. The accident occurred in front of the TIR garage in the Esentepe neighborhood of Vezirköprü district. It was claimed that a truck carrying fertilizer from Çorum could not stop due to a malfunction in its braking system starting from the Kızılcaören area and traveled uncontrollably for about 5 kilometers. The truck collided with a minibus carrying students that had stopped at the traffic lights at the entrance of the district, and then with a truck belonging to the Regional Directorate of Highways with the license plate 55 BD 985, as well as a passenger minibus with the license plate 55 M 9009 that was found to be empty.
19 PEOPLE INJURED
As a result of the collision, the service minibus with the license plate 55 PG 391, which was taking students from Bahçekonak neighborhood to school, fell into the garden of a site approximately 4 meters high by the roadside. The truck then stopped after colliding with a TIR with the license plate 57 ABR 291. A total of 19 people were injured in the accident, including 10 students. Police and medical teams were dispatched to the area upon notification. The 19 injured individuals were taken to the hospital by ambulances. An investigation has been initiated.
